A related question:

A referee recommended to calculate the conjoint significance between 2 maps in a conjunction analysis using the Fisher's tecnique, that is, by calculating

chi square = -2ln(p1*p2)

, where p1 and p2 are the level of significance (one-tailed) of the two individual maps.

I have two questions: First, do you think this method of estimating conjoint significance is correct?

Second, because my AFNI maps are two-tailed, should I use p1/2 and p2/2 in that equation?
